Member of Commission I of the House of Representatives Christina Aryani asked for the commitment of the candidate for the Commander of the Indonesian National Armed Forces, Admiral Yudo Margono, to resolve the legal case involving TNI soldiers, including the case of mutilating Papuans.

According to him, this has been conveyed in the fit and proper test of the candidate for the TNI Commander in Chief carried out by Commission I of the DPR on Friday, December 2.

"We have succeeded in asking for his commitment to continue the good practice of the TNI Commander General Andika regarding the process and enforcement of the law against soldiers involved in violations of the law and criminal acts," said Christina in a statement, Sunday, December 4, which was confiscated by Antara.

He said, in resolving these criminal cases, the main principle is that law enforcement is carried out completely, transparently, and fairly.

Christina said she also asked Admiral Yudo to think about a special strategy related to handling the "hot spot" area, especially the North Natuna Sea, because many violations of sovereignty were found.

"We believe that Admiral Yudo as the new TNI Commander is able to give his best and the DPR supports the implementation of his duties in the future to continue to synergize for the benefit of the nation and state," he said.

In addition, he believes that Admiral Yudo Margono is able to carry out his mandate as TNI Commander well, because he sees the track record of the person concerned.

Christina assessed that Admiral Yudo was a responsive and communicative figure, as seen from the track record and experience of the person concerned when he was the Chief of Staff of the Navy (KSAL).

"I believe Admiral Yudo is able to lead the TNI organization professionally and is able to maintain good commitments and partnerships, including with the DPR," he said.

Previously, the internal meeting of Commission I of the DPR on Friday afternoon December 2, approved Admiral Yudo Margono as TNI Commander, after he underwent a series of fit and proper tests for the candidate for the TNI Commander.

"After considering the views of the factions and members, Commission I of the DPR RI has approved the appointment of Admiral Yudo Margono as TNI Commander," said Chairman of Commission I DPR RI Meutya Hafid, at the Parliament Complex, Jakarta.

He explained that all factions agreed to appoint Admiral Yudo Margono as TNI Commander, so that in the internal Commission I meeting the DPR would not vote or "vote".

Meanwhile, the DPR Plenary Meeting on approval to ratify TNI Admiral Yudo Margono as TNI Commander will be held on Tuesday, December 6.
